ntroduction: Graphic design plays a crucial role in shaping the processes through which meaning is produced, communicated, and understood in contemporary societies. By employing elements such as images, symbols, colours, typography, and layout, graphic design functions as a visual language that articulates cultural values, identities, ideologies, and social messages. The discipline of semiotics, which studies signs and their meanings, provides a valuable theoretical framework for understanding how graphic design communicates beyond mere visual appeal. This research explores the construction and interpretation of meaning within graphic design practices in Uganda from a semiotic perspective. Methods: The research employed a cross-sectional design utilising a qualitative method. Data were gathered from active graphic designers, art educators, advertising professionals, and members of the general populace. A total of 70 respondents were chosen through stratified random sampling. The data collection was conducted via structured questionnaires and subsequently analysed using descriptive statistical techniques. The data were analyzed thematically, guided by semiotic categories and emergent meanings derived from participant narratives and visual materials. Results: The research indicated that colours, symbols, images, and typography serve as essential semiotic instruments within Ugandan graphic design, utilised to convey cultural identity, social values, and commercial messages. Respondents noted that indigenous symbols and colours are predominantly employed to elicit cultural familiarity, whereas contemporary layouts and typography are influenced by Western design principles. Conclusions: The study establishes that graphic design in Uganda operates as a semiotic system in which meaning is negotiated among designers, cultural context, and audiences. Although global design trends influence practice, local cultural symbols remain significant in the process of meaning-making. Enhancing semiotic awareness among designers may improve the effectiveness and cultural sensitivity of visual communication.
UNDERSTANDING MEANING IN GRAPHIC DESIGN: A SEMIOTIC EXPLORATION OF VISUAL COMMUNICATION IN UGANDA
×
Error message
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Notice: Trying to access array offset on value of type int in element_children() (line 6609 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
- Deprecated function: implode(): Passing glue string after array is deprecated. Swap the parameters in drupal_get_feeds() (line 394 of /home3/ijcsrd79/public_html/journalijisr.com/includes/common.inc).
Country:
Uganda
Volume & Issue:
Volume 07, Issue 12, December 2025
Page No:
9340-9344
Abstract:
KeyWords:
Semiotics, Graphic Design, Visual Communication, Meaning-Making, Visual Signs, Culture, Uganda.
